3. Ariel
Most of The Little Mermaid is spent "under the sea", and so we'll focus on Ariel's marine aesthetic for her makeup style. While vibrant red hair may be her most striking feature, this aquatic princess's purple and green outfit is a close second—and even though the two hues might sound intimidating, it can easily be done if a light touch is used! Choose a purple eyeshadow (or liner, if you want a more defined look) and line your upper and lower lashes, then select a bright green shade for your lid. A shimmery green shade would be best; you might not have eyes as large as Princess Ariel's, but the shimmer will help enhance them! Apply sparingly, and blend well before adding a very small dose of brown, waterproof mascara—just in case you do end up going on an impromptu swim.
